The Invalid password error message can mean that any of the following are
wrong:
- POP3 server name
- Incoming Mail Server Account Name (some require the full e-mail address
, others just want the user part)
- Incoming Mail Server Password (often case sensitive)
- Incorrect use of Secure Password Authentication (SPA) - few severs use
this
- Incorrect use of SSL - few servers use this
- The mail server is having temporary problems *** If you hadn't made any
changes prior to the problem starting, this is the most probable cause.
It's a lot more common than most ISPs will admit. ***
- Anti-Virus scanning e-mail or anti-spam program interfering with the
mail server logon
Check these settings in Outlook Express at Tools, Accounts, Mail,
Properties, Servers (Advanced tab for SSL). Check with your mail service
(generally your ISP) for the correct values. If the values seem correct,
retype them and click APPLY. In the event that the account settings are
corrupted in the registry, it might be necessary to delete the mail
account, restart OE and then set up the account again. In some cases it
might be necessary to set up a new identity in OE and create the mail
account there.

Using XPSP2 and IE7: I've been sending/receiving email OK for long time.
Today, I couldn't send; received a small window titled Log on
mail.bellsouth.net. Please enter user name and password for the following
server: mail.bellsouth.net. User name is correct and cursor is blinking
in password line. I've replaced password at least 10 times; no help. I've
gone to the mail.bellsouth.net server and replaced the password there at
least 10 times; still no help. Antivirus email scan is turned off. I get
error message 0x800CCC92 which is invalid password. Can anyone help me on
this?
